Choices : A Lakehouse or Estate with FHA Lending?

News Wire:  The House and Senate have voted to raise the FHA lending limit to $729,750.  As a result, Woodstock GA luxury properties like these just became even more attainable because of lower down payments.

John Wieland Homes and Neighborhoods to begin construction on new homes in Woodstock Downtown

John Wieland Homes will be finishing the Woodstock Downtown community left half-complete when the original developer/builder,  Hedgewood, had to close it’s operation due to the market collapse.
